2025 was a turning point for your electricity bill and it’s just getting more expensive from here. It’s not just data centers
Electricity bills in the US have seen a significant surge, with retail prices rising 7% in 2025 and a nearly 40% increase since 2021, marking the fastest growth in decades. While data centers are often blamed for this trend due to their high energy consumption, experts suggest this is only part of the story. Other major factors contributing to the rising costs include the need to upgrade aging grid infrastructure and the extensive damage caused by extreme weather events like wildfires and hurricanes, which have necessitated costly repairs and infrastructure investments by utility companies.
